php课程 4-16 数组自定义函数(php数组->桶)
php课程 4-16 数组自定义函数(php数组->桶)
一、总结
一句话总结:php的数组储存机制,和桶排序完美的结合。所以php的操作中多想多桶的操作。
二、数组自定义函数
1、相关知识
php中的函数只是php官方给php的一些常用功能进行了封装,写成了函数,其实我们是都可以写那些函数的。
2、代码
统计数组中所有值的重复次数
 <?php 
 $arr=array(1,2,3,1,5,7,2,3,1,2,1,2,1,1);
 foreach($arr as $val){
     $arr2[$val]++;
 }
 echo "<pre>";
 print_r($arr2);
 echo "</pre>";
  ?>
php课程 4-16 数组自定义函数(php数组->桶)的更多相关文章
- PHP基础函数、自定义函数以及数组
		
2.10 星期五 我们已经真正开始学习PHP 了,今天的主要内容是php基础函数.自定义函数以及数组, 内容有点碎,但是对于初学者来说比较重要,下面是对今天所讲内容的整理: 1 php的基本语法和 ...
 - PHP中使用数组指针函数操作数组示例
		
数组的内部指针是数组内部的组织机制,指向一个数组中的某个元素.默认是指向数组中第一个元素通过移动或改变指针的位置,可以访问数组中的任意元素.对于数组指针的控制PHP提供了以下几个内建函数可以利用. ★ ...
 - 3205: 数组做函数参数--数组元素求和1--C语言
		
3205: 数组做函数参数--数组元素求和1--C语言 时间限制: 1 Sec 内存限制: 128 MB提交: 178 解决: 139[提交][状态][讨论版][命题人:smallgyy] 题目描 ...
 - PHP-自定义数组-预定义数组-自定义函数-预定义函数
		
(1)自定义数组 —— 项目中的重点 (2)PHP预定义数组 —— 重点&难点 (3)自定义函数 —— 了解 (4)PHP预定义函数 —— 项目中的重点 1.自定义数组 数组:array,一个 ...
 - PHP移动互联网开发笔记(4)——自定义函数及数组
		
一.自定义函数 自定义函数就是我们自己定义的函数,在PHP中自定义函数格式如下: function funname(arg1, arg2, arg3......){ //TODO return val ...
 - [ 随手记 2 ] C/C++ 数组/指针/传数组到函数/指针数组/数组指针
		
1.=================================================================== 1,数组是一块内存连续的数据.2,指针是一个指向内存空间的变 ...
 - 输入整数n(n<=10000),表示接下来将会输入n个实数,将这n个实数存入数组a中。请定义一个数组拷贝函数将数组a中的n个数拷贝到数组b中。
		
代码一大串! #include<stdio.h> ],y[]; void arraycopy (double c[],double d[],int m); { ;i<=m;i++) ...
 - 2016/7/7 自定义函数copy
		
题目:输入整数n(n<=10000),表示接下来将会输入n个实数,将这n个实数存入数组a中.请定义一个数组拷贝函数将数组a中的n个数拷贝到数组b中. 分析: (1)输入n,再输入n个实数存入数组 ...
 - C 二维数组,以及自定义二维数组
		
C 二维数组,以及自定义二维数组 我们通常情况下是这样定义一个二维数组的: int a[10][15]; 我们分别查看一下a,a[0],*a 都是一样的值吧 我们可以这么理解: a是一个数组的数组 a ...
 
随机推荐
- word2vec源代码解析之word2vec.c
			
word2vec源代码解析之word2vec.c 近期研究了一下google的开源项目word2vector,http://code.google.com/p/word2vec/. 事实上这玩意算是神 ...
 - Lamp(linux+apache+mysql+php)环境搭建
			
Lamp(linux+apache+mysql+php)环境搭建 .安装apache2:sudo apt-get installapache2 安装完毕后.执行例如以下命令重新启动apache:sud ...
 - 90.#define高级用法
			
define把参数变成字符串 #define f(x) printf("%s",#x); define连接两个字符串 #define a(x) a##x define把参数变成字符 ...
 - Android 6.0 最简单的权限获取方法 RxPermition EasyPermition
			
Android 6.0 要单独的获取权限 这里提供两种很简单的方法 EasyPermition RxPermition EasyPermition https://github.com/googles ...
 - 韦东山网课https://edu.csdn.net/course/play/207/1117
			
接口讲解https://edu.csdn.net/course/play/207/1117
 - 初学者路径规划 | 人生苦短我用Python
			
纵观编程趋势 人生苦短,我用Python,比起C语言.C#.C++和JAVA这些编程语言相对容易很多.Python非常适合用来入门.有人预言,Python会成为继C++和Java之后的第三个主流编程语 ...
 - [Angular] Using the Argon 2 Hashing Function In Our Sign Up Backend Service
			
Which hash algorithom to choose for new application: https://www.owasp.org/index.php/Password_Storag ...
 - DB2 概览
			
2006:IBM公布DB2.9.将数据库领域带入XML时代.IT建设业已进入SOA(Service-Oriented Architecture)时代.实现SOA.其核心难点是顺畅解决不同应用间的数据交 ...
 - JDBC高级特性(二)事务、并发控制和行集
			
一.事务 事务是指一个工作单元,它包括了一组加入,删除,改动等数据操作命令,这组命令作为一个总体向系统提交运行,要么都运行成功,要么所有恢复 在JDBC中使用事务 1)con.setAutoCommi ...
 - (转)30 IMP-00019: row rejected due to ORACLE error 12899
			
IMP: row rejected due IMP: ORACLE error encountered ORA: value too large , maximum: )导入日志报 IMP: 由于 O ...